The Cloth
Woven with love and care
The rare character and beauty of Harris Tweed is made by truly traditional methods. Hundreds of distinctive patterns developed over the centuries, each unique but unmistakably Harris Tweed with its characteristic subtle designs in complex natural shades.
Unusually our wool is dyed before being spun, allowing us to blend a multitude of colours into our yarn. With each thread containing a myriad of different colours a cloth of great depth and complexity is produced. Just look closely to reveal the true nature of your Harris Tweed. Each bolt of cloth similar but never the same.
There are also an extensive catalogue of designs to delve into from an array of plain twills and traditional herringbones to more complex plaids and all combinations thereof. Harris Tweed is also adventurous enough to be woven into contemporary and unconventional patterns.
Soft, tactile, breathable, warm, colourful, sustainable and adaptable...the old image of coarse, scratchy, dour tweed simply does not exist these days. While still retaining its heritage of practicality and longevity, the Harris Tweed of today extols all the qualities and virtues of a truly luxury 21st century fabric.
